Originally I didn't suspect this to be a problem with WhatPulse, but when I was told the next day that my family computer is experiencing the exact same issue which has nothing in common with my computer other than WhatPulse, it's the only thing I can think of.
Basically, the keyboards for both computer have suddenly started going out of control within 24 hours of each other. Certain function keys like CTRL are unusable, spacebar keys frequently pressed and sometimes it even begins to type things I had typed earlier, even after the computer had been shut down subsequently. I've tried system restoring to before the issue began, but it made no difference, so I'm wondering if any other WhatPulse users have suddenly started experiencing this issue. RE: Uncontrollable Keyboard
(01-16-2013 07:46 PM)Teliko Wrote: sometimes it even begins to type things I had typed earlier, even after the computer had been shut down subsequently.Apparently this can be caused by devices that can record macros, such as the Microsoft Sidewinder mouse. I'm fairly certain WhatPulse wouldn't and couldn't do that! |
